6.5 Finishing the functional shank
CAUTION
Incorrect protective equipment
Injury due to defective or lack of protective equipment.
Wear protective goggles and a dust mask during grinding.
Shortening the functional shank
Complete the following steps to shorten the functional shank:

1) Bring the prosthesis to full extension.
2) Measure from the bottom edge of the
upper knee part to the top edge of the foot
connection plate.
3) Add 15 mm to the measured length and
transfer this to the functional shank.
INFORMATION:
shank, measure from the top to the bot­
tom.
4) Cut off the functional shank at the marked
location.
INFORMATION: Note the foot position
for an optimum fitting result.
